Jieyang is projected to experience significant climate challenges, primarily characterized by heavy rainfall events and frequent heavy precipitation. These conditions will likely lead to increased flooding and waterlogging, threatening local infrastructure and livelihoods. Additionally, the city faces a heightened risk of arbovirus transmission, indicating a possible surge in diseases carried by vectors such as mosquitoes, which could impact public health. Furthermore, an elevated risk of malaria associated with shifting climate patterns suggests growing health vulnerabilities among the population. These intertwined climate hazards may exacerbate social and economic challenges, ultimately affecting community resilience and overall well-being. As these risks unfold, addressing them will be crucial for future sustainability and health in Jieyang.
